Revitalizing Ashbridges Bay: A Sustainable Future for Toronto’s Waterfront

The Ashbridges Bay Landform Project aims to enhance navigation and ecological health at Ashbridges Bay, Toronto, while managing sediment accumulation and shoreline erosion. Completed by June 2025, the project involves major structural elements like headlands, breakwaters, and erosion control structures. Highlights include:

– The perimeter of the Landform was completed in June 2021, with significant placement of topsoil and erosion protection measures finalized.
– The Central Breakwater is close to completion, featuring habitat enhancements like submerged tree fields and naturalized shorelines.
– Construction includes 14,527 m² of cobble shoreline and underwater habitat shoals to support local ecology.

Key public engagement occurred through Community Liaison Committees and Public Information Centres to gather community input. The project aims to restore natural areas and enhance recreational opportunities by the end of 2025.
